Advertisement
Agus_Darmawan

4.2. Latihan perulangan Do-While Bahasa C Bahasa C

Jul 29th, 2019
310
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 3.17 KB | None | 0 0
  1. DIBAWAH INI ADALAH SOAL PERULANGAN MENGGUNAKAN WHILE-DO - MENGGUNAKAN BAHASA C
  2.  
  3. /* ========================================================================================= */
  4. = (1) =
  5. /* ========================================================================================= */
  6. Materi: DO-WHILE
  7.  
  8. Kondisi Awal: {
  9. - system menyuruh user untuk memasukkan namanya
  10. }
  11. Kondisi akhir yang diharapkan: {
  12. - system menampilkan nama user sebanyak 10 kali
  13. }
  14.  
  15.  
  16.  
  17. /* ========================================================================================= */
  18. = (2) =
  19. /* ========================================================================================= */
  20. Materi: DO-WHILE
  21.  
  22. Kondisi Awal: {
  23. - System menyuruh user memasukkan BANYAK DATA yang ingin dimasukkan.
  24. - Misal data yang ingin dimasukkan sebanyak 5 data.
  25. - setelah user memasukkan BANYAK DATA, kemudian menyuruh user memasukkan data / nilai sebanyak "BANYAK DATA" yang dimasukkan sebelumnya".
  26. - misal data ke 1 adalah 8, data ke 2 adalah 4, data ke 3 adalah 90, data ke 4 adalah 23, dan data ke 5 adalah 80.
  27. - DATA INI DIMASUKKAN OLEH USER, BUKAN DI MASUKKAN DI DALAM KODINGAN!!!
  28. }
  29. Kondisi akhir yang diharapkan: {
  30. - system menampilkan banyak data, dan menampilkan semua data yang dimasukkan sebelumnya beserta index / posisi dari data tersebut (misal 1. data yang dimasukkan adalah 8, dst)
  31. }
  32.  
  33.  
  34.  
  35.  
  36. /* ========================================================================================= */
  37. = (3) =
  38. /* ========================================================================================= */
  39. Materi: DO-WHILE + IF-ELSE
  40.  
  41. Kondisi Awal: {
  42. - system menyuruh user untuk memasukkan nilai awal yang ingin dicetak, dan nilai akhir yang ingin dicetak (BERUPA INTEGER).
  43. }
  44. Kondisi akhir yang diharapkan: {
  45. - system menampilkan nilai tersebut (dari nilai awal, SAMPAI nilai akhir dicetak dilayar keluaran).
  46. - dengan kondisi: 1. jika nilai yang akan diprint adalah ganjil, maka tulis nilainya, dan keterangan bahwa nilainya ganjil
  47. 2. jika nilai yang akan diprint adalah genap, maka tulis nilainya, dan keterangan bahwa nilainya genap
  48. }
  49.  
  50.  
  51.  
  52. /* ========================================================================================= */
  53. = (4) =
  54. /* ========================================================================================= */
  55. Materi: DO-WHILE + IF-ELSE
  56.  
  57. Kondisi Awal: {
  58. - system menyuruh user untuk memasukkan rentang nilai (diberikan nilai awal dan akhir <seperti soal nomer 3>)
  59. }
  60. Kondisi akhir yang diharapkan: {
  61. - system memproses dan menampilkan rentang nilainya di layar.
  62. - dengan kondisi: 1. jika nilainya ganjil, maka jangan print nilainya
  63. 2. jika nilainya genap, maka print nilainya
  64. }
  65.  
  66. /* ========================================================================================= */
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ement